Can you discuss how Overwolf enables developers to create, distribute, and monetize apps for existing games?
Passionate gamers who were also techies chimed in and helped in the creation of content for their favorite games.
But, up until today, these creators were scattered, isolated, and out of the spotlight.
Millions of gamers enjoy their creations, but they dont get the credit or the compensation for it.
They lack the advanced tools, the distribution, or the resources AAA developers already have.
Overwolf is changing that by being the all-in-one platform for in-game creators.
Aside from the tech platform, Overwolf offers creators a lot of resources to get started and stay focused.
